Output 921c6ddc052d677cdbfcfae91a33b3ec830244ea4ce85fc7445314366e20d53c:1

value
3506394
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 176bbc645d4b9fccbb374284c159db839787d205 OP_EQUALVERIFY OP_CHECKSIG
address
138qc2ykSM88LmRsmdCb2Mwc3CYG8adXLw
transaction
921c6ddc052d677cdbfcfae91a33b3ec830244ea4ce85fc7445314366e20d53c
confirmations
326519
spent
true